Washington | Republicans in the House of Representatives failed for a second straight day to elect a leader on Wednesday (Thursday AEDT), as a faction of holdouts repeatedly defied former president Donald Trump’s call to unite behind his ally Kevin McCarthy.

After three failed votes and a round of closed-door talks, Mr McCarthy appeared no closer to securing the post of House speaker, a powerful job second in the line of succession to the presidency.
